Sedimentary Characteristics and Depositional Model of A New Type of Reservoir in Feixianguan Formation, Puguang Gas Field

By the observation of the drilling core, it is found that a new type of reservoir, named gravel-sized grain carbonate rocks, is mainly distributed in the Feixianguan Formation of Puguang Gas Field in the foreslope of platform. Based on the analysis of gravel composition, development scale, grain size and degree of roundness, it could be divided into calcirudyte and dolorudite. It is shown that small scale calcirudyte is mainly formed by long distance transportation and with relationship to the turbidity current; and large scale dolorudite is mainly formed by no moving or by short distance transportation and with relationship to the collapsing sediment. In the sedimentary model of gravel-sized grain carbonates in slope belt in Feixianguan Formation of Puguang Gas Field, the source of calcirudyte is from the carbonate platform, and the big scale dolorudite is usually distributed in the upper slope belt where the favorable reservoir is well developed, but the thin calcirudyte is distributed in the lower slope where the reservoir is not developed.关键词
